Getting joint replacement patients up and moving soon after surgery is one of the keys to preparing them for same-day discharge. Our nurses expressed concerns that standard- sized post-op areas in most surgical facilities don't have enough open floorspace for patients to ambulate safely and confidently. That's why we'll create a 450-square-foot physi- cal therapy area adjacent to our recovery bays. There, physical therapists will guide joint replacement patients through mobility exercises and teach them the basic skills they need to master — getting up and down from a seated position and walking up and down stairs — before we discharge them. Patients who meet discharge criteria will exit the facility directly from the physical therapy area. • Expansive ORs. The facility's 600-square-foot standardized surgical suites will function as multipurpose spaces where our surgeons can perform a wide range of procedures, from basic knee arthroscopies to complex hip arthroplasties. We didn't skimp on size when designing the ORs, supersizing them in order to give surgical team members more room to maneuver around the additional equipment — C-arms, mobile fluid waste man- agement units and robotic platforms — we'll need to perform increasingly complex joint and spine procedures. Each room will house a robust IT system that will support electronic medical records and inventory management software.
